Default Sh 4 foel shortage

Hi, I'm on SH4 hard mode, having trouble getting back to base with over half a tank of diesel. Have to call in to Midway after leaving Pearl to refill otherwise cannot get to target. Any ideas?

First thought that come to my mind is: SLOW DOWN!

10kts speed will usually get you over 10,000 miles, in some boats a lot more.
If running at Full or Flank your Mileage drops WAAAAY down.

mikesn9 is correct. Slow down and cruise at 10 knots. Historically speaking most boats when leaving Pearl Harbor on patrol would stop at Midway and top off their fuel tanks before departing on patrol for Empire waters or beyond. Once you leave Midway conserve fuel and cruise at 10 knots to your patrol area. Once you reach your patrol area use 10 knots to patrol your area and use higher speeds when chasing targets.

If you're confident in editing, add these changes.
Ctrl-w gives you the weather up top.
Shift-g will give you estimated range on the fuel you have left.
Always copy the file to a safe place first, in case you mess up.
( I never make mistakes. Once I thought I did, but I was wrong)
As you use the fuel range, you'll notice big differences in range between charging/not charging batteries.
After you go to 1.5, TMO/TMOwtw have this change incorporated in the game already.

Here is the info:

Fuel range at current speed:
So, in: \Data\Cfg\Commands.cfg
Commands.cfg (open with a text editor like Notepad
)

[Cmd257] <------------------ Step #1: Find "[Cmd257]
"
Name=Report_time_to_turn
Ctxt=1
MnID=0x3F250002
Key0=0x47,s,"Shift+G" <--------- Step #2:
Add this string

----------------------------------------------------------------------
If you also want the 'Weather Report' "Ctrl+W" make this [Cmd261] edit:

[Cmd261]
Name=Report_weather
Ctxt=1
MnID=0x3F250006
Key0=0x57,c,"Ctrl+W" <--------- Step #3:
Add this string

----------------------------------------------------------------------
To remember "Shift+G" and "Ctrl+W" add them to your in-Game F1 Help file:
In: Data\Menu\Help\Help.cfg
Help.cfg (open with a text editor like
Notepad
, and find the 'OTHER CONTROLS' section:

[Chapter1.Phrase6]
Phrase=<b>OTHER CONTROLS</b>| NumPad - Decrease Time Compression| NumPad + Increase Time Compression| Backspace Pause|

-------------------------------
Step #4
: and add Ctrl+W & Shift+G:

[Chapter1.Phrase6]
Phrase=<b>OTHER CONTROLS</b>| Ctrl+W Weather Report| Shift+G
Maximum
range at current speed| NumPad - Decrease Time Compression| NumPad + Increase Time Compression| Backspace Pause|

----------------------------------------------------------------------
As always back up any files you edit in case you make a mistake

Yep... When based at Pearl early in the war, my routine is to go to Midway at STANDARD speed, refuel and conduct the mission at 10 kt, return to Midway for fuel and return to Pearl at STANDARD... Later in the war, other refueling options are available that are closer than Pearl... Also, transferring to Fremantle later in the war opens up more refueling options, allowing more shooting time.
